This is a controversial but powerful tip. The ARSC file maps every resource in the res/ directory. If you have a large, static file (like a font, a shader, or a JSON config), moving it from res/raw/ to assets/ removes its entry from the ARSC entirely. arsc better

android { buildTypes { release { shrinkResources true minifyEnabled true } } } When you run this, the build tool rewrites the ARSC file, removing resource IDs that lead to nowhere. The result is a cleaner, smaller, and functionally . 2. Leverage Resource Configurations (Qualifiers) Android supports resource qualifiers (e.g., drawable-hdpi , values-en-rUS ). However, including too many unnecessary configurations bloats the ARSC. A better ARSC only contains what the device actually uses.

Before we discuss making ARSC better , let’s define it. The resources.arsc file is a compiled binary file that contains the index of all resources within an APK. It maps resource IDs (e.g., 0x7f010023 ) to actual file names, types, configurations, and values. Think of it as a card catalog for your app’s layouts, strings, dimensions, colors, and drawables.
